Harvester Smart Rolling Grow Table

For urban farmers and commercial growers alike, limited cultivation space remains an enduring challenge. The Harvester Smart Rolling Grow Table presents an innovative solution that maximizes every square inch of available area while dramatically improving operational efficiency.

Space Optimization Through Modular Design

The Harvester system's core innovation lies in its exceptional flexibility. Unlike conventional fixed growing platforms, these rolling tables feature customizable dimensions that adapt to any cultivation environment - from narrow greenhouse aisles to expansive indoor vertical farms or compact home growing systems.

When integrated with proprietary modular growing trays, the system creates continuous cultivation lines that maintain optimal plant spacing. The seamless integration allows growers to easily reconfigure their layout based on changing needs.

Engineering for Efficiency

Harvester's design prioritizes both durability and user experience. The aluminum frame ensures structural stability, while galvanized steel components provide corrosion resistance in humid environments. Powder-coated adjustable legs accommodate various working heights and growing methods.

The manual hand-crank mechanism enables effortless repositioning of tables - a feature that proves particularly valuable during maintenance, irrigation, or harvesting operations. This simple yet effective design eliminates the spatial constraints of traditional fixed growing systems.

Operational Advantages for Commercial Growers
  • Increased planting density through optimized space utilization
  • Streamlined workflow with easy-access channels between tables
  • Improved growing conditions through better air circulation
  • Adaptability to various cultivation methods including hydroponics and soil-based systems

The system's configuration process considers multiple factors including facility dimensions, crop types, and cultivation methods to ensure optimal performance. By eliminating wasted space and simplifying routine operations, the Harvester system represents a significant advancement in controlled environment agriculture technology.
